There is no true "convention" on this ( as far as i can see )
Some authors of celestial calculations use Sth as zero ( ie Meeus/Trueblood and Genet ) and others use Nth is zero ( ie Duffet Smith ) .
The arrangement of the calculations to convert RA/DEC to AltAz etc then depend on the convention chosen.
( Meeus notes that the Nth vs Sth convention was different between astronomers and navigators )
I know Meade use the Nth is zero convention, probably so they can match it to the "Level/Nth" start position, so to simplify the internal calcs, Nth is still zero, irrespective of hemisphere.
